
There's a new trailer for upcoming Meek Mill docuseries Free Meek

The first trailer for Amazon's upcoming docuseries on Meek Mill has arrived.
Free Meek is executive-produced by Jay-Z, who also features in the documentary.
The Amazon Original series will span five episodes, and "exposes the story of Philadelphia rapper Meek Mill’s 2017 arrest for probation violations. An investigation of his original case explores allegations of police corruption as Meek becomes the face of a powerful justice reform movement."
Meek Mill released his Champions record last year, and recently featured on DJ Khaled's "You Stay" with Lil Baby and Jeremih.
He will also feature on Ed Sheeran's No.6 Collaborations Project that lands next month.
Free Meek arrives on Amazon Prime Video on 9 August.
